Frequently Asked Questions about chalets in Grasmere

  • What’s the best one-day sightseeing plan for Grasmere?

    Start your day with a walk around Grasmere village, stopping by the Grasmere Gingerbread Shop for a treat. Then, head to the Grasmere Lake and take a stroll around the perimeter, enjoying the views of the surrounding fells. In the afternoon, visit Rydal Mount, the former home of William Wordsworth, and explore the gardens. For dinner, enjoy a meal at one of the local pubs in Grasmere.

  • Which landmarks are the most popular in and around Grasmere?

    Grasmere is known for its picturesque scenery, including Grasmere Lake, the village itself, and the surrounding fells. Popular landmarks include Rydal Mount, Dove Cottage, and the Grasmere Gingerbread Shop. You can also find plenty of scenic walks in the area, like the Grasmere to Rydal path.

  • What wildlife might you spot near chalets in Grasmere?

    Near chalets in Grasmere, you might spot red squirrels scampering in the trees, grey squirrels, rabbits hopping in the fields, and various bird species. You might even catch a glimpse of a red deer or a buzzard soaring overhead.

  • Which historical sites in Grasmere are fun for children?

    Dove Cottage, the former home of William Wordsworth, is a great place to visit with children. They have interactive exhibits and activities that bring the history of the poet to life. The Beatrix Potter Gallery in nearby Hawkshead is also a popular destination for families, with its charming illustrations and interactive exhibits.

  • Are there popular tourist attractions close to Grasmere?

    Yes, there are many popular tourist attractions within easy reach of Grasmere. You can visit the Lake District National Park, explore the nearby towns of Ambleside and Keswick, or take a boat trip on Lake Windermere. The World of Beatrix Potter attraction in nearby Bowness-on-Windermere is a popular choice for families.
